From: David Yang <davidcomponentone@gmail.com>

The coccinelle check report:
"./tools/testing/selftests/vm/split_huge_page_test.c:344:36-42:
ERROR: application of sizeof to pointer"
Using the "strlen" to fix it.

Reported-by: Zeal Robot <zealci@zte.com.cn>
Signed-off-by: David Yang <davidcomponentone@gmail.com>
---
 tools/testing/selftests/vm/split_huge_page_test.c | 2 +-
 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)

I think the code really just wants to write anything to the file that 
will be >= 1, which is also the case with this weird usage of sizeof.

As an alternative, I think we can just write anything else to the file

num_written = write(fd, (void *)&fd, sizeof(fd));

or

num_written = write(fd, "1", 1);

If I am not wrong/
